Overview

Australia is a world leader in the management, conservation and sustainable use of the marine environment and maintains an active interest in ensuring effective and complementary approaches to marine conservation on a regional and global level. This minor sequence gives you a global perspective. You'll gain an introduction to Aboriginal studies and intercultural communication, and have the opportunity to participate in a global environmental placement while exploring topics in conservation and sustainability.

Please note, students considering SLE301 Professional Practice as part of their global engagement minor, the placement component of this unit must be completed in an international setting.
